It's important to remember that learning to drive is a process, and everyone learns at their own pace. When you plan how to teach your kid to drive, explain the concepts and critical importance of car insurance and vehicle registration. While car ownership and operation aspects are less sexy than perfecting driving skills, they are all part of being responsible. Remember how we started this discussion about how to teach someone to drive by having you check your car insurance? Some states, like California, require all drivers, including student drivers, to be covered by car insurance. Teens living at home with their parent(s) can be added to a parent’s existing car insurance.

Whether you’re teaching a teenager or an adult who’s learning to drive for the first time, the key to successful driving lessons is taking things at the student’s pace. Some students may be ready to hit the highway after only a few lessons, while others may need to spend a lot of time on basic driving skills before they handle traffic. If you listen to your student and encourage them with a positive attitude, they should be ready to handle the car safely when they get their driver’s license. The amount of time it takes to learn to drive can vary based on several factors, including individual abilities, the frequency of practice, and the type of vehicle being driven. However, on average, it takes about 20 to 30 hours of practice to gain a basic level of proficiency in driving.
